Justin: jow@math. Description: Math 241 is the most advanced of the three basic calculus courses. We shall cover such topics as vectors, vector-valued functions, multiple integrals, line and surface integrals as well as the important fundamental calculus theorems. Goal/Intro: Most of MATH 241 (Multivariable Calculus) takes place in 3D space so we need to understand visually how all this works. 2. In addition to the x and y axis we add an extra axis, the z-axis. Simplify your answer as much as possible. cherry ridge gun range Answer: The vector field is tangential to circles. If we move around a circle in the direction of the arrows, the function f would have to keep increasing (since grad f = F).
